Q: Is 115,535,525 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 115,535,525 is a composite number.

Why is 115,535,525 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 115,535,525 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 25 35 61 79 137 175 305 395 427 553 685 959 1,525 1,975 2,135 2,765 3,425 4,795 4,819 8,357 10,675 10,823 13,825 23,975 24,095 33,733 41,785 54,115 58,499 75,761 120,475 168,665 208,925 270,575 292,495 378,805 660,203 843,325 1,462,475 1,894,025 3,301,015 4,621,421 16,505,075 23,107,105 and 115,535,525, with no remainder.

Since 115,535,525 cannot be divided by just 1 and 115,535,525, it is a composite number.
